Is Nutmeg Safe for Shiba Inus?
Nutmeg is not safe for Shiba Inus and should never be offered. Nutmeg is toxic to dogs — myristicin causes serious neurological symptoms for Huskys. There is no safe serving size — even tiny amounts can cause serious harm.
Causes disorientation hallucinations seizures and in large amounts death. If your Shiba Inu has accidentally eaten Nutmeg, do not wait for symptoms. Contact your vet or ASPCA Poison Control (888-426-4435) immediately — early treatment dramatically improves outcomes.
